About the Hotel

625 Hotel Circle South, San Diego, California, United States of America, 92108

Hotel Iris - Mission Valley-San Diego Zoo-Seaworld is a 2-star property in Mission Valley, home to several malls and shopping centers. The 79-room hotel features an outdoor pool, free WiFi throughout, and ADA-compliant facilities.

Modern Room Amenities

Each of Hotel Iris's rooms includes a 50-inch HDTV, microwave, refrigerator, coffee maker, and climate control. Private bathrooms feature full baths, complimentary toiletries, and plush towels.

Local Dining Options

The hotel location offers direct access to San Diego's renowned Mexican cuisine and seafood restaurants. Several dining venues are within walking distance.

Recreation and Activities

Hotel Iris provides access to golfing, biking, parasailing, windsurfing, boating, kayaking, and hiking activities. The outdoor pool offers year-round recreation.

Central City Location

Located within 2 miles of San Diego Zoo, Downtown San Diego, Balboa Park, and Old Town State Park. San Diego International Airport is 2.5 miles away.
